Output ad332156ebd1428325437cb85deb1286376d6b4dcc331fe1a121e177db144675: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9ddf16706275195099883a2eec79714cca0419 OP_EQUAL
address
MDWxaEP7Yh2Zdy6BGCWPi9y5pT3EwbwVGu
transaction
ad332156ebd1428325437cb85deb1286376d6b4dcc331fe1a121e177db144675
spent
true